SEATTLE – BECU has awarded a $2,500 grant to Lake Hills Elementary School to pay for a tutor for the upcoming MSP (Measurements of Student Progress) tests.
BECU is awarding Lake Hills with a $2,500 grant to purchase access to Math-Whizz, which all 470 students at the school will use to learn math.
Math-Whizz is an online learning environment crawling with animated creatures that teaches children addition, subtraction, multiplication, division and computational problem solving. Lake Hills determines how often students access the program based on their MAP scores three times a year. A student who is excelling might log into Math-Whizz twice per week while a student who is struggling might engage the program up to twice a day.
